The microsphere powder material conveying line typically consists of several key components that work in tandem to achieve smooth material transport. These components include a hopper for material storage, a feeder to control the flow rate, a conveyor system (such as a screw or pneumatic conveyor), and a control unit to manage the entire process. Each component plays a vital role in maintaining the integrity of the microsphere powder and preventing issues like clogging or degradation. The hopper is designed to hold a sufficient quantity of microsphere powder, ensuring a steady supply to the feeder. The feeder, often a rotary or vibratory type, regulates the material flow by adjusting the speed or pressure, preventing overfeeding or underfeeding that could disrupt the conveyor system. The conveyor system, whether mechanical (e.g., screw conveyor) or pneumatic (e.g., air slide or pressure conveyor), transports the powder through the line. The control unit monitors parameters such as flow rate, pressure, and temperature to maintain optimal conditions. This integrated approach ensures that the microsphere powder is moved safely and efficiently from the source to the destination, minimizing the risk of material loss or contamination.

The pneumatic conveying system, for instance, uses compressed air to move the powder through a pipeline, while the mechanical system relies on rotating screws or belts to transport the material. Both systems are designed to handle the delicate nature of microsphere powders, preventing breakage or agglomeration.

The operation of the microsphere powder material conveying line can be broken down into several sequential steps. First, the system is prepared by checking the hopper and feeder for any blockages or obstructions. The control unit is then activated, and the feeder is set to the desired flow rate based on the production requirements. Next, the conveyor system is started, and the microsphere powder begins to move through the line. During operation, the control unit continuously monitors the system's performance, adjusting flow rates or pressure as needed to maintain stability. At the end of the conveying process, the material is discharged into the receiving container or processing unit. The system is then shut down, and the hopper is emptied or refilled as required. This step-by-step process ensures that the conveying line operates smoothly and reliably, meeting the demands of industrial applications. Each step is critical to preventing downtime and ensuring consistent material transport. The preparation phase involves inspecting all components for wear and tear, while the activation phase focuses on setting the correct parameters for the current production batch. The monitoring phase allows for real-time adjustments, ensuring that any deviations are addressed promptly. The shutdown phase ensures that the system is safely turned off and that the material is fully transferred to the destination.

Microsphere powder material conveying lines are versatile and find applications in multiple industries. In the chemical industry, these systems are used to transport fine powders used in the production of coatings, pigments, and specialty chemicals. The pharmaceutical industry utilizes them for handling active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) and excipients, ensuring that the powders are transported without contamination or degradation. In the food processing sector, microsphere powder conveying lines are employed to transport food-grade powders, such as flavorings or colorants, maintaining hygiene and product safety. Each application benefits from the precise control and reliability of the conveying line, making it an essential tool for modern industrial operations. For example, in the chemical industry, the conveying line helps in transporting microsphere powders used in the manufacturing of paints and inks, where consistent particle size and flow are critical. In the pharmaceutical industry, the system ensures that the microsphere powders used as excipients are handled with care, preventing any contamination that could affect the final drug product. The food processing industry benefits from the hygienic design of the conveying line, which meets strict regulatory standards for handling food-grade materials.
